50 câu hỏi 60 phút
Tổ chức FSF là tổ chức:
Phần mềm mã nguồn mở
Phần mềm tự do
Quỹ phần mềm nguồn mở
Phần mềm miễn phí
Tổ chức FSF (Free Software Foundation) là tổ chức phi lợi nhuận được thành lập với mục đích thúc đẩy và bảo vệ quyền tự do sử dụng, nghiên cứu, phân phối và sửa đổi phần mềm. Vì vậy, đáp án đúng là "Phần mềm tự do".
Tổ chức FSF (Free Software Foundation) là tổ chức phi lợi nhuận được thành lập với mục đích thúc đẩy và bảo vệ quyền tự do sử dụng, nghiên cứu, phân phối và sửa đổi phần mềm. Vì vậy, đáp án đúng là "Phần mềm tự do".
Ubuntu là một hệ điều hành mã nguồn mở dựa trên Debian, và nó được phát hành theo giấy phép GNU General Public License (GPL). Giấy phép này cho phép người dùng tự do sử dụng, sửa đổi và phân phối phần mềm. Window Xfree86 và JavaFBP toolkit không sử dụng giấy phép GNU GPL.
Câu hỏi này liên quan đến việc chạy các ứng dụng Windows trên hệ điều hành Ubuntu sử dụng các phần mềm mã nguồn mở miễn phí.
Do đó, đáp án chính xác nhất là "Wine và CrossOver" vì cả hai đều là các phần mềm (hoặc dựa trên phần mềm) mã nguồn mở miễn phí giúp chạy các ứng dụng Windows trên Ubuntu. Wine là nền tảng cơ bản, còn CrossOver là một phiên bản thương mại dựa trên Wine.
"Wine door và Cedega" không đúng vì Wine door không phải là một phần mềm phổ biến hoặc được công nhận rộng rãi trong lĩnh vực này, và Cedega đã ngừng phát triển.
"Wine và PlayOnlinux" cũng là một đáp án gần đúng, tuy nhiên, CrossOver là một lựa chọn tốt hơn PlayOnlinux nếu xét về tính năng và hỗ trợ (mặc dù không hoàn toàn miễn phí). Tuy nhiên, câu hỏi chỉ yêu cầu phần mềm mã nguồn mở miễn phí, nên cả Wine và PlayOnlinux đều phù hợp.
Tuy nhiên, do đáp án "Wine và CrossOver" có phần "Wine" là đáp án đúng, nên đây vẫn là đáp án phù hợp nhất với yêu cầu của câu hỏi.
Khi cài đặt Linux, tối thiểu cần hai partition:
Vì vậy, đáp án đúng là "2".
Lệnh rpm -ivh packagename.rpm
dùng để cài đặt gói phần mềm có tên packagename.rpm
. Trong đó:
rpm
: là lệnh gọi trình quản lý gói RPM.-i
: viết tắt của install, nghĩa là cài đặt.-v
: viết tắt của verbose, hiển thị thông tin chi tiết trong quá trình cài đặt.-h
: hiển thị thanh tiến trình (hash marks) trong quá trình cài đặt.packagename.rpm
: là tên của gói phần mềm RPM cần cài đặt.Các lựa chọn khác không đúng vì:
rpm -evh packagename.rpm
: Lệnh này dùng để gỡ bỏ (erase) gói phần mềm, không phải cài đặt.rpm -q packagename.rpm
: Lệnh này dùng để truy vấn (query) thông tin về gói phần mềm đã cài đặt.rpm -qa *.rpm
: Lệnh này dùng để liệt kê (query all) tất cả các gói RPM đã cài đặt, không phải để cài đặt một gói cụ thể.